Just look at this lag, las time i came to this forum saying that my game was like 58fps looking like 30fps and now i'm getting this insane lag even on main menu...

List of what's not causing the issue

Virus - Clean instalation with original windows 10 without the previous data 
GPU - Good temperature and driver instalation
CPU - Temperature not even reaching 60º(GPU at 62º or less)
SSD - No bad blocks or delayed sectors
RAM - Working perfectly no error during health tests

MODs - Lag even without  mods subscribed, cache files and any date related to mods.

My config

Fx8300 + Rx550 4GB / 2x4GB (This setup on my country is preety damn high cost so it's the best that i can have so... upgrading isn't a option right now...)

Windows is repeatedly advertising it has a new audio device and FMOD the audio driving engine is unable to use it as the current device. Please check your audio devices through mmsys.cpl. You can access this by going to the start menu, typing in mmsys.cpl, and selecting the control panel item to bring up your audio devices available. Since Windows is advertising that your default device is switching frequently try right clicking on your default audio device, select properties in the menu, and click on the advanced tab. You might want to adjust the format used to something typical like 16 or 24 bit 44100 or 48000 Hz. Turning off exclusive control of this device is another thing that can be done here that I would advise changing. If these do not fix it look at your other audio devices to see if anything would be trying to take over as the primary device and try disabling audio output devices you do not use by right clicking on them and choosing the disable option.
